JDU’s J&K President, DDC member, delegations call on LG
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

Srinagar: GM Shaheen, President of J&K Janta Dal United (JDU), called on Lieutenant Governor Manoj Sinha at Raj Bhawan today.

Shaheen discussed with the Lt Governor various public important issues pertaining to the fixation of rates of Houseboats and Hotels, completion of pending development works, and avenues to boost the economy of Srinagar during Shri Amarnathji Yatra.

He also extended the support and cooperation of his party in the smooth conduct of Shri Amarnathji Yatra.

The Lt Governor assured Shaheen that the issues projected by him will be looked into earnestly for early redressal.

Meanwhile, Choudhary Shaista, DDC Member from Faqir Gujri Srinagar called on Lieutenant Governor Manoj Sinha.

The DDC Member apprised the Lt Governor of various development issues and implementation of the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ana in her constituency.

A delegation of the Indian Engineers’ Federation (INDEF) headed by its Chairman S. Ananth, submitted a memorandum of demands to the Lt Governor pertaining to various welfare issues of the engineering community.

Later, a delegation of Water-sports athletes from J&K also called on the Lt Governor.
